共用方式為


AuthorizationRule 類別

表示組態檔授權區段中的規則。

Syntax

class AuthorizationRule : CollectionElement  

方法

這個類別不包含任何方法。

屬性

下表列出 類別所 AuthorizationRule 公開的屬性。

名稱 描述
AccessType 讀取/寫入 sint32 列舉,指定是否根據 、 UsersVerbs 屬性所 Roles 指定的值組合,授與 URL 資源的存取權。 後續的一節會列出可能的值。 注意: 在執行時間,授權模組會逐 AuthorizationRule 一查看元素,直到找到符合特定使用者的第一個規則為止。 然後,它會根據 屬性的值 AccessType 授與或拒絕對 URL 資源的存取。
Roles 必要的唯一讀取/寫入 string 值,其中包含授與或拒絕 URL 資源存取權的角色逗號分隔清單。 索引鍵屬性。 注意:屬性或 Roles 屬性中必須至少有一個值 Users ,或是兩者。
Users 必要的唯一讀取/寫入 string 值,其中包含被授與或拒絕 URL 資源存取權的使用者逗號分隔清單。 預設值為 "*"。 索引鍵屬性。 注意:屬性或 Roles 屬性中必須至少有一個值 Users ,或是兩者。
Verbs 必要的唯一讀取/寫入 string 值,其中包含 HTTP 傳輸方法的逗號分隔清單,可授與或拒絕 URL 資源的存取權。 索引鍵屬性。

子類別

這個類別不包含子類別。

備註

這個類別的實例包含在 AuthorizationAuthorizationSection 類別的 屬性中。

下表列出 屬性的 AccessType 可能值。

關鍵字 描述
0 Allow 針對您在 、 UsersVerbs 屬性中指定的 Roles 值組合,授與 URL 資源的存取權。
1 Deny 拒絕存取您在 、 UsersVerbs 屬性中指定的值組合的 Roles URL 資源。

繼承階層架構

CollectionElement

AuthorizationRule

規格需求

類型 描述
Client - Windows Vista 上的 IIS 7.0
- Windows 7 上的 IIS 7.5
- Windows 8 上的 IIS 8.0
- Windows 10上的 IIS 10.0
伺服器 - Windows Server 2008 上的 IIS 7.0
- Windows Server 2008 R2 上的 IIS 7.5
- Windows Server 2012 上的 IIS 8.0
- Windows Server 2012 R2 上的 IIS 8.5
- Windows Server 2016上的 IIS 10.0
產品 - IIS 7.0、IIS 7.5、IIS 8.0、IIS 8.5、IIS 10.0
MOF 檔案 WebAdministration.mof

另請參閱

System.Web.Configuration.AuthorizationRuleCollectionElement 類別